Educating Using Plain Language: Nighttime Postural Care Assessment Training Package, Faye Mcguire

Doctor of Occupational Therapy Doctoral Projects

Background. There is a lack of high-quality research and inadequate training available to healthcare professionals and caregivers on Nighttime Postural Care (NTPC). Purpose. The purpose of this project was to 1) develop a training package on NTPC assessments to educate caregivers of children with cerebral palsy (CP) and the research team, and 2) educate clinical scientists on plain language.

Approaches. The author used the Patient Education Materials Assessment Tool (PEMAT) and Program for Research Institute of Medicine and Science (PRISM) Editing Checklist to evaluate training materials and generated recommendations. Assistive Technology And Older Adults: Education To Support Evidence-Based Practice, Danielle Erler

Doctor of Occupational Therapy Doctoral Projects

Background: In 2020 there were over 54 million older adults in the U.S. (USCB, 2020). Nearly 90% of these older adults intend to live in their homes and communities for as long as possible (AARP, 2011) although nearly 40% of individuals 65+ report having at least one disability (USCB, 2014). Community partner LiveLife Therapy Solutions (LLTS) seeks to provide assistive technology (AT) services to community-dwelling individuals of all ages, supporting their independence. Nursing Competency Alignment Project (Ncap), Lainey S. Kotta

Doctor of Nursing Practice Projects

Background: The lack of a standardized nursing competency model for a large healthcare organization prevented it from opportunity as a system.

Objective: This evidence-based project's purpose was to select a nursing competency model that a large healthcare organization will use to evaluate nurses, standardize nursing competency training language for the healthcare organization, develop an education plan for nurse educators on the selected nursing competency model, and develop an implementation plan for the nursing competency model.
